Killorglin
Killorglin is a gateway to the beautiful Iveragh Peninsula situated on a hill overlooking the wide and graceful River Laune, a river offering salmon and trout angling. Dominating the landscape to the south are the MacGillycuddy's Reeks. This is a good holiday base for touring, and Killorglin is the location of the famous 'Puck Fair' festival - Ireland's largest and the world's oldest business event.
